# LLM Profile Comparison Implementation Plan
Status: Ready for implementation.
## Purpose And Authority
This document is the ordered implementation plan for the accepted [LLM
Profile Comparison Roadmap](profile-comparison.md). Implement every stage in
numeric order. The roadmap owns feature purpose, policy, scope, and target
state; this plan owns implementation sequence, concrete interfaces, and stage
exit criteria.
This is one feature delivered over ten bounded coding prompts. A stage may
refactor code needed by a later stage, but it must leave the repository
compiling, tested, and internally coherent. Do not expose an incomplete
`compare` command before the stages that implement its full command contract.
## Implementation Rules
Apply these rules in every stage:
- Read `docs/development.md`, the task-specific documents it identifies, and
all files under `docs/policy/` before changing code. Treat those documents
and the feature roadmap as binding.
- Preserve the existing behavior of `generate` and `run`, including output
precedence, report/date semantics, notification, debug capture, structured
results, and exit behavior.
- Keep Promptkit types and calls behind `internal/adapters/promptkit` and the
dependency-neutral `internal/promptexec` interface. Do not import Promptkit
from application, CLI, or comparison-artifact packages.
- Keep comparison artifacts operator-owned and explicit. They are not durable
application state and must never be discovered or consumed implicitly by a
later invocation.
- Do not add a Weatherreporter concurrency limit or semaphore. One shared
Promptkit executor is safe for concurrent use, and Promptkit v0.5.0 owns its
engine-local backend capacity.
- Use dependency injection and deterministic fakes for application and CLI
tests. Tests must be offline, credential-free, race-safe, and independent of
completion timing and machine-specific paths.
- Add regression coverage in the same stage as each behavior. Prefer
contract-level assertions over incidental implementation detail, in
accordance with `docs/policy/testing.md`.
- Run `gofmt` on changed Go files and `git diff --check` in every stage. Run
focused tests while developing, then `GOWORK=off go test -count=1 ./...`
before completing the stage. Stages that add concurrency or filesystem
replacement must also run the relevant packages with `-race`.
- Do not commit, tag, push, or prepare a release unless the implementing prompt
separately requests it.

### Comparison And File Identity
Use the resolved report metadata's existing run ID to form:
```text
comparison_<report-run-id>
```
This comparison ID is computed once from the injected clock and shared by the
application result, manifest, and debug identities.
Derive a profile filename slug as follows:
1. retain ASCII letters, ASCII digits, `-`, and `_`;
2. replace each run of every other character, including dots, whitespace,
separators, control characters, and non-ASCII characters, with one `-`;
3. trim leading and trailing `-` and `_`;
4. use `profile` if the result is empty; and
5. truncate the result to 64 ASCII bytes, then trim trailing `-` and `_` again,
falling back to `profile` if necessary.
The report filename is:
```text
<ordinal>-<slug>.md
```
The one-based ordinal width is the greater of two and the number of decimal
digits in the profile count. Filename collisions after slug normalization are
safe because the ordinal is authoritative. The exact profile ID remains the
logical identity in results and the manifest.
Derive a default comparison directory by requiring the resolved report output
name to end in the exact `.md` suffix, removing that suffix, and prefixing the
remaining basename with `comparison-`. Resolve it beneath configured
`output.directory`, or beneath the invocation working directory when no output
directory is configured. An explicit `--out-dir` is the exact bundle directory,
resolves relative to the invocation working directory, and completely
overrides configured output. Return an absolute cleaned path.

### Destination Safety And Publication
Perform a read-only destination preflight before prompt inspection, weather
collection, directory creation, or model execution. Reject:
- a filesystem root;
- the exact invocation working directory;
- an existing regular file or non-directory;
- an existing symlink, including a dangling symlink;
- an uninspectable target; and
- a nonempty directory unless `--replace` is present and it is a recognized
current-schema Weatherreporter comparison bundle.
An absent target and an existing empty real directory are accepted without
`--replace`. `--replace` is also harmless for those cases. Recognition must
decode the manifest with unknown fields rejected, validate every manifest
invariant, require `data-package.yml` and every declared successful report to
be regular non-symlink files, verify the data-package digest, and require the
directory entries to be exactly the manifest, data package, and declared
successful reports. Extra files, subdirectories, links, missing files, invalid
paths, duplicate paths, or a failed digest make the directory unrecognized.
Never follow a manifest path outside the bundle.
Re-run the destination safety check immediately before publication. Build the
entire logical bundle in memory, create the parent only when publishing, and
write a private uniquely named sibling staging directory with directory mode
`0700` and files mode `0600`. Check cancellation while staging and immediately
before the commit operation.
For an absent target, atomically rename the completed sibling staging directory
to the target. For an existing empty or recognized target, rename the target to
a unique sibling backup, rename staging to the target, and restore the backup
if the second rename fails. If restoration also fails, retain the backup and
return an actionable joined error that identifies its path. Once this rename
transaction begins, finish commit or rollback without abandoning it because of
a concurrent cancellation. The final pre-commit context check is the
linearization point: cancellation observed before it prevents replacement;
cancellation arriving after it does not retroactively undo a completed commit.
Remove the backup after a successful replacement and clean staging artifacts on
ordinary failures without scanning or modifying unrelated paths.
### Shared Preparation And Concurrent Execution
Extract an immutable internal prepared-report value containing the resolved
report, collection-derived facts, module snapshot, briefing metadata,
generated-text handler/render inputs, source warnings, and the one serialized
data-package byte sequence. Preparation resolves, collects, derives, snapshots,
and marshals once.
Split the generated-text workflow into three internal responsibilities:
1. deterministic shared preparation;
2. one profile-specific Promptkit execution, validation, and in-memory
Markdown rendering; and
3. publication, with optional ordinary notification.
`GenerateDetailed` composes those responsibilities once and retains its current
single-report behavior. Comparison never calls `GenerateDetailed` in a loop.
For comparison, inspect the exact prompt once, then inspect every profile
sequentially in selection order, including effective backend, model, and
credential availability, before weather collection. Initialize an explicitly
requested debug writer before those operations so pre-execution diagnostics
retain current behavior. Any preflight failure causes no collection, model
calls, or bundle publication.
After shared preparation, start one goroutine per profile against one shared
executor. Pass the same immutable data-package bytes and exact inspected prompt
version to every call. Preallocate an ordered outcome slice and let each
goroutine write only its own index; use synchronization to join all goroutines.
One profile failure does not cancel peers. Parent cancellation propagates to
every call, no additional calls are started after cancellation is observed, and
all started goroutines are joined before return.
Give each execution a deterministic debug run identity:
```text
<comparison-id>_<ordinal>-<slug>
```
The existing debug preparation artifact remains authoritative for the exact
profile ID. Debug callback failure is a failure of only that profile and must
not collide with or cancel peers.
After all non-cancelled outcomes finish, order them by original selection,
capture one UTC finish timestamp, and construct the complete or coherent
partial bundle. Publish partial bundles when one or more profiles fail, then
return the non-nil result with a generic aggregate error so the CLI exits
nonzero. Do not include provider detail in that aggregate error. Cancellation
or deadline expiration publishes no bundle. No comparison path constructs or
calls a Distributor notifier.
